Five Owls Earn 2008 Arthur Ashe, Jr. Sports-Scholar Athlete Awards

HOUSTON, TEXAS (June 11, 2008) Rice women's tennis standouts Julie Chao, Tiffany Lee and Rebecca Lin along with women's basketball players Maudess Fulton and Shyrelle Horne garnered 2008 Arthur Ashe, Jr. Sports-Scholar Awards as announced in Diverse Magazine's June issue.

Chao, Lee and Fulton tallied Third-Team honors, while Horne and Lin took home Honorable Mention selections.

Chao, a 2008 C-USA All-Academic team member, carries a 3.60 GPA as an economics major. She racked up a 22-10 overall singles record en route to All-Conference USA First Team singles pick.

Lee and Lin anchored the middle of the Rice lineup as the Owls completed a 17-5 season, its best since the 1983 season. Lee won 10 of her 13 singles decisions at the No. 3 slot and Lin was 14-6 in the No. 4 hole.

Fulton, a three-time C-USA Commissioner's Honor Roll winner, averaged 8.1 points and 3.4 rebounds per game. The New Jersey native holds a 3.39 GPA as a history major and netted a career-high 27 points on an 11-for-21 shooting effort at UCLA and secured C-USA Player of the Week for her efforts.

Horne served as Rice's back-up point guard before missing the final 13 games of the season with a shoulder injury. She saw double-digit minutes in nine times and passed out at least three assists in six of those nine games.
